    Abstract : This thesis highlights the role of phase interfaces on phasetransformations in metallic materials. The deviation from localequilibrium at the moving phase interface has been analysed interms of solute drag theory and finite interface mobility. Inparticular the planar growth of proeutectoid ferrite fromaustenite in steel has been studied. READ MORE

    Abstract : In the first part of this thesis, the FE program MSC.Marc is applied for coupled thermomechanical simulations of wire-rod rolling. In order to predict material behaviour of an AISI 302 stainless steel at high strain rates generated during wire-rod rolling, a material model based on dislocation density is applied. READ MORE
